Job Description

Timeless Spa seeks a driven, compassionate, skilled, licensed Esthetician to join our team. The ideal candidate will be passionate about skincare and cosmetic procedures and have excellent communication skills.

Key Responsibilities:
• Skilled in facial and skincare procedures such as chemical peels, microdermabrasion, body treatments, cryo, and microneedling.
• Conducting skin analysis assessments and consultations to determine the best treatment plan for clients.
• Providing recommendations for skincare products and at-home skincare routines.
• Educating clients on proper skincare techniques and post-treatment care.
• Ability to assess clients' skin conditions and recommend appropriate treatments.
• Keeping detailed records of client treatments and progress, making notes of any allergies and skin conditions the client may have.
• Maintaining cleanliness and sterilization of all equipment.
• Adhering to all legal and ethical standards related to aesthetic procedures and client confidentiality.

Requirements:
• Current Esthetician license.
• Experience in medical esthetics
• Knowledge of skincare products and treatments.
• Strong communication and interpersonal skills
• Excellent time management skills
• Must be able to work a flexible schedule
• Must have excellent time management skills
